Abstract

By using the NexSPheRIO code, we study the elliptic-flow fluctuations in Au+Au collisions at 200A GeV. It is shown that, by fixing the parameters of the model to correctly reproduce the charged pseudo-rapidity and the transverse-momentum distributions, reasonable agreement of <v_2> with data is obtained, both as function of pseudo-rapidity as well as of transverse momentum, for charged particles. Our results on elliptic-flow fluctuations are in good agreement with the recently measured data in experiments.
